Buscar
Mostrando ítems 1-10 de 12
Artículo
TANDEM: A Taxonomy and a Dataset of Real-World Performance Bugs
(IEEE Computer Society, 2020)
The detection of performance bugs, like those causing an unexpected execution time, has gained much attention in the last years due to their potential impact in safety-critical and resource-constrained applications. Much ...
Artículo
A Survey on Metamorphic Testing
(2016-02-29)
A test oracle determines whether a test execution reveals a fault, often by comparing the observed program output to the expected output. This is not always practical, for example when a program’s input-output relation is ...
Artículo
Performance mutation testing
(Wiley, 2021)
Performance bugs are known to be a major threat to the success of software products. Performance tests aim to detect performance bugs by executing the program through test cases and checking whether it exhibits a noticeable ...
Artículo
Priorización de casos de prueba. Avances y retos
(Asociación de Técnicos de Informática, 2013)
Artículo
Priorización de casos de prueba: Avances y retos
(ATI: Asociación de técnicos de Informática, 2013)
La priorización de pruebas consiste en establecer un orden de ejecución para los casos de prueba que permita alcanzar un determinado objetivo. Por ejemplo, es posible reordenar los casos de prueba para detectar fallos lo ...
Artículo
Mutation testing in the wild: findings from GitHub
(Springer, 2022)
Mutation testing exploits artificial faults to measure the adequacy of test suites and guide their improvement. It has become an extremely popular testing technique as evidenced by the vast literature, numerous tools, ...
Artículo
Multi-objective test case prioritization in highly configurable systems: A case study
(Elsevier, 2016)
Test case prioritization schedules test cases for execution in an order that attempts to accelerate the detection of faults. The order of test cases is determined by prioritization objectives such as covering code or ...
Artículo
Variability testing in the wild: the Drupal case study
(Springer, 2017)
Variability testing techniques search for effective and manageable test suites that lead to the rapid detection of faults in systems with high variability. Evaluating the effectiveness of these techniques in realistic settings ...
Informe
Metamorphic Testing: A Literature Review - Version 1.3 (Technical Report ISA-16-TR-02)
(2016)
A test oracle determines whether a test execution reveals a fault, often by comparing the observed program output to the expected output. This is not always practical, for example when a program’s input-output relation ...
Informe
Automated Metamorphic Testing on the Analysis of Software Variability: Technical Report ISA-2013-TR-03
(2013)
Variability determines the ability of software applications to be configured and customized. A common need during the development of variability–intensive systems is the automated analysis of their underlying variability models, ...